About the job Project Manager - Substation

Major responsibilities for the Project Manager will include:

  • Prepare proposals, assist in presentations, and participate in contract negotiations.
  • Provide overall management of projects from concept to completion including siting, environmental, permitting, planning, estimating, engineering, right-of-way acquisition, project controls, bid phase services, procurement, constructability reviews, material management, construction management, and closeout.
  • Develop and monitor project schedules, manage scope, and control project costs.
  • Assist with internal project financials (detailed, accurate project cost forecast and accruals), staffing, legal coordination, risk management, change management, and human resource issues.
  • Serve as primary point of contact with client regarding efforts such as client coordination, strategic planning, master scope management, budget finances, subcontracting, project staffing, environmental compliance, facility support and schedule attainment.
  • Manage all aspects of project communication.
  • Develop and implement project policies and procedures, establish project controls systems and implement the project execution plan.
  • Conduct quality reviews on substation design projects (physical or P&C) as needed.
  • Work closely with the Project Team to ensure deliverables and services are being provided to clients satisfaction and that projects are following internal QA/QC guidelines.
  • Report regularly on progress, cost and schedule metrics, procurement issues, safety or environmental concerns, design questions, potential impacts, and any issues requiring office support.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in electrical engineering from an accredited curriculum.
  • Minimum of seven years of utility substation project experience with at least 3 years related project management experience.
  • Professional Engineering (PE) registration preferred.
  • Project Management Professional (PMP) certification preferred.
  • Must have ability to deal effectively with a wide variety of industry, government and public contracts on project-related matters.
  • Strong analytical and problem solving skills.
  • Ability to travel.
  • Valid driver's license required.
  • In addition, must meet standards to qualify for and maintain the Company's vehicle
